Volunteers Make Playground a Reality for Autistic Children

Giant Steps Illinois joins forces with nonprofit playground builders KaBOOM! and Radio Flyer.

Slithery slides and shifting sands, treasure tumbles and tick-tack-toe spinning bands—these are a few of the hundreds of pieces that a few hundred helping hands put together for hundreds of smiles and hours of fun to come. Over 500 hands helped build Giant Steps school's first playground this month. The school, which caters to children suffering autism disorders, completed the effort with the help of their volunteers, students, the Radio Flyer company, and funding from from nonprofit playground builder KaBOOM! and Blue Cross And Blue Shield. Crews completed the work in two days. Giant Steps began as a home school and moved into its current facility off Warrenville Road just over a year ago.
